What is the important part of your website ? I think it is a website data. If you are using one of website applications (like image gallery, CMS, blog, discussion board etc.) probably most of the information will be stored in the database. What can occur to my database information ? Without this information these applications aren't worth a lot. I know, web host must take care of it, but. If your information is valuable for you, it is recommended to get database backup as well as website files backup regularly (depending on your information growth).
